I have an adult duck that is having a problem, I have read about a hundred threads and can find nothing that sounds exactly like her problem. I do not know how old she is or what kind, but i have had her over a year and I have been noticing the problem for about a week, but it seems to be getting worse. She is about the size and coloring of a metzer golden 300, she might be something else, but looks just like one of those.

She will be walking along or standing just fine, then her legs start to shake, her whole body tenses up and she stretches up onto her toes then her wings shoot out and she just lays down. She will lay for a while, then she gets up and is fine again...

So far in treating possible problems I have been giving her some epsom salt water to flush out toxins, if that is the problem. I am alternating that with antibiotic water, niacin water, probiotic water and electrolyte water trying to cover all of the bases.

I don't water to cause more problems with these treatments, so if anyone has seen anything like this before, please let me know if you figured out the problem and what you did to treat it.

she is still eating good, she drinks and she is laying eggs still.
